Vancouver GAA - Championship Week 3 - Results
Another exciting display of hurling, camogie and football took place in Burnaby last week. First up, we had the senior hurlers out on Tuesday night.
Both Cú Chulainns and Wolfe Tones found the net five times throughout the game, but the Cú’s came away with the win. Next up were the Intermediate hurlers. A high-scoring affair saw Cú Chulainn emerge with a ten-point win over JP Ryan’s.
Their movement and point-taking kept the scoreboard ticking over, allowing them to maintain control despite JP Ryan’s regular visits to the net.
On Wednesday evening, we had the Senior Camogie JP Ryan’s and Cú Chulainn’s teams out first. The Cú’s battled hard throughout the whole game but JP Ryan’s ladies proved too strong on the night.
The Junior Hurling match that followed later that evening saw Wolfe Tones claim a strong win over JP Ryan’s with goals setting these two teams aside on the night.
Thursday evening saw the football back in action with the Intermediate Men’s match up first. The closest game of the week produced a dramatic finish as St. Finnian’s edged Éire Óg by a single point.
The Junior Ladies was the last game of the week and it was an exciting one. Fraser Valley Gaels secured a hard-fought two-point win in a tightly contested encounter. Scores were difficult to come by as both defences worked tirelessly throughout, but Fraser Valley held firm to claim the win.
